Mid-tier businesses confident, KPMG Enterprise pre-Budget survey finds

KPMG Australia’s mid-market businesses are upbeat, and markedly less worried about the ending of the JobKeeper program than they were six months ago, KPMG Enterprise’s annual pre-Budget survey finds. The survey of 100 mid-tier business leaders and directors found two-thirds (68 percent) had either used government support mechanisms through COVID and were ’emerging with confidence’, or said that new opportunities had emerged as a direct result of the past year’s experience. Less than half said that COVID or other factors had negatively impacted the business. Only one-third expected the recent ending of the JobKeeper scheme to lead to a significant decline in economic activity and higher unemployment. This compared to two-thirds in the equivalent KPMG Enterprise survey just ahead of the October Budget last year. Almost one-half had used JobKeeper and one-third the instant asset write-off scheme.

Corporate Tax Transparency report shows increase in tax paid

Date Time Corporate Tax Transparency report shows increase in tax paid The Australian Taxation Office (ATO) continues to lead the world in providing insights into the operation of the corporate tax system with the publication of the sixth annual report on corporate tax transparency. The report covers the tax affairs of the largest companies operating in Australia. Deputy Commissioner Rebecca Saint said the report included tax information from 2,311 corporate entities with a combined total income tax paid of $56.1 billion in 2018-19. “Over 60% of all corporate income tax in 2018-19 was paid by the companies included in this report,” Ms Saint said.
